摘 要:为评价东江干流(惠州段)鱼类多样性,并监测其水质变化状况,根据该河段鱼类的调查资料及历史数据,编制了鱼类名录,并计算了鱼类平均分类差异指数和G-F多样性测度指数。结果显示,东江干流(惠州段)共记录近30多年来鱼类11目,29科,77属,94种,鲤形目鱼类占绝对优势;从物种水平看,研究的4个时间段鱼类物种多样性由大到小排序为Δ1+981-1983、Δ2+011-2012、Δ2+007-2010和Δ2+005-2007;从科属水平看,鱼类物种多样性由1981~1983向2005~2007减小,再向2007~2010增加,最后向2011~2012减小。其中,1981~1983的多样性最高,2011~2012的多样性最低。平均分类差异指数与G-F多样性测度指数均适宜于东江干流(惠州段)鱼类物种多样性研究。Based on the investigation data and the historical data of fish species during more than 30years in Huizhou Reach of Dongjiang River, the fish diversity was assessed and the changes of water quality was monitored. The species check-list of fish recorded-and-investigated was compiled and the average taxonomic distinctness and G-F diversity index were calculated. The cypriniformes were dominated and the total of 94species were devided into 77genera, 29families and 11orders. The order form large to small of the fish diversity was 1981 1983+ -Δ , 2011 2012+ -Δ , 2007 2010+ -Δ2005 2007+ -Δ . The diversities decreased from the 1981~1983to the 2005~2007, then increased to the 2007~2010, and finally decreased to the 2011~2012. Thereinto, the diversity was the highest in 1981~1983and the lowest in 2011~2012. The average taxonomic distinctness and G-F diversity index are fit to research the fish species diversity in Huizhou Reach of Dongjiang River.
